Class Action Lawsuit Against Innovative Industrial Properties, Inc.
Innovative Industrial Properties, Inc. (IIPR), a prominent real estate investment trust, is currently facing a class action lawsuit concerning alleged securities fraud. The Gross Law Firm has officially notified shareholders about this ongoing action, which allows affected individuals to address their rights and potential claims.
Background of the Case
The lawsuit indicates serious allegations against IIPR, particularly concerning the company’s purportedly misleading statements regarding its financial health. Shareholders who acquired IIPR shares between February 27, 2024, and December 19, 2024, are being encouraged to contact the firm to discuss potential lead plaintiff appointments. Importantly, the appointment as a lead plaintiff is not a requirement for participating in the case's recovery.
Allegations Detailed
The complaint presents several critical allegations:
- - False Statements: IIPR allegedly made materially false and misleading statements about its financial performance.
- - Rent Declines: The company reportedly faced significant declines in rent and property-management fees, which were not disclosed to investors.
- - Revenue Impact: Due to these declines, the company's ability to maintain funds from operations and revenue growth was likely impaired.
- - Profitability Concerns: IIPR's leasing operations have been suggested to be less profitable than claimed, leading to misinformation being presented to investors.
These aspects raise serious concerns about the accuracy and transparency of the information being provided to shareholders, which is particularly pertinent given the critical timelines for registration and participation in the lawsuit.
